earlier test of the AIS NB-IoT Arduino shield, I touched on the fact that the AIS 923MHz NB-IoT network tested illustrated "not the best reliability" due to spotty 923MHz cell tower penetration / coverage.
However, on the ocean side of my condo, I have improved this reliability issue a few DB (my RF power meter is not very accurate, sorry) with this antenna:
More importantly than potential antenna gain, the 923MHz NB-IoT signal is considerably more reliable after placing the antenna at the window and off my desktop (which is about 3 to 4 meters away from the window).
